Physics Informed Machine Learning for Space Power System Diagnostics and Control

ORAU is part of the NASA Postdoctoral Program, which offers unique research opportunities for talented scientists. This role focuses on developing physics informed machine learning techniques to enhance fault diagnostics and control for space-based power systems.

Responsibilities

Derive physics informed machine learning techniques to support fault diagnostics and control of space based power systems

Required

Background in engineering, computer science, or a similar field
Background in software tools such as Matlab, Python, and C/C++
Experience developing machine learning algorithms
Strong mathematical foundation specifically in linear algebra, differential equations, and optimization
Solid communication and teamwork skills
Degree: Doctoral Degree
